Biography

Jawbox played their first show opening for Fugazi in 1989. Jawbox was highly organized and ready to work, and the band immediately set out touring and recording. They released their first single on the Desoto/Dischord split label in 1990. Bassist Kim Coletta borrowed the Desoto label name from another DC band, Edsel, on which to release the Jawbox single. 5.0 out of 5 stars Brilliant stuff: loud guitars, abrasion, huge pop hooks, January 5, 1999
By A Customer
This review is from: Novelty (Audio CD)
Perhaps no post-punk band anywhere has so succesfully married the seemingly opposite qualities of pop melody and abrasion / angst / avant-garde dissonance as Washington, D.C.'s, late lamented Jawbox. Imagine the Pixies as serious intellectuals . . . except Jawbox are more intense / loud, more musically adventurous, and (at least to my ears) have even stronger hooks than the Pixies did. An even better reference would be the pop side of Mission of Burma (an increasingly obvious influence on their next two records). Every Jawbox CD has some lesser tracks which simply recycle their formula, or which try new things and don't quite work, but when they are on their game, they are as good as it gets. NOVELTY might be their best, although it's neither their most adventurous nor most consistent CD. "Static," "Spiral Fix"," and especially "Dreamless" and "Spit-Bite" rank among their handful or two of best all-time songs.
